I installed cygwin in my PC. After that, I also wanted to install "The
Jam utility" (http://www.perforce.com/jam/jam.html).  I encountered
some problems and the reason is because the PATH variable (printenv
PATH) contains some Windows-based directories (like:
/usr/X11R6/bin:/cygdrive/c/Programes Files/Common Files/Symbian/Tools)

I tried to run "jam.exe" and the error was "This application has
failed because cygwin1.dll was not found. Re-installing the appication
may fix this problem"

Any suggestion how to remove the space character from the PATH variable?
